Electricity and energy: Egypt case

  • 1. Ministry of Electric Power and Energy, Cairo (Egypt). Qattara Project Authority

Description

This paper shows the evolution of the pattern of the energy consumption in Egypt for the last three decades and indicates that the growth rate of energy consumption will continue with lower growth rates but the trend indicates substantial rate of electric energy consumption. Statistical data on power generation are also given. 6 figs., 6 tabs
